Memphis splits doubleheader Thursday at Jacksonville

Redbirds dominate game one, allow walk-off single in game two

July 31st, 2026

JACKSONVILLE, Fla. – The Memphis Redbirds continued a six-game road trip at the Jacksonville Jumbo Shrimp (Triple-A, Miami Marlins) with a doubleheader split on Thursday night at Vystar Ballpark. 

Memphis used the longball to jump ahead quickly in game one’s 11-4 victory. Third baseman Nolan Gorman drilled a two-run shot as part of a four-run top of the first inning. Center fielder Joshua Báez clobbered his 32nd home run of the season with a two-run homer in the second. Báez finished game one 3-for-4 with two doubles and four RBIs. 

Starting pitcher Brandt Thompson (1-1) allowed two runs on five hits, walked two and struck out five to earn his first career Triple-A win. Andrew Schultz worked a scoreless frame in relief and struck out two batters. 

The Redbirds dropped game two in walk-off fashion by a final score of 4-3. In the loss, designated hitter Thomas Saggese hit his seventh Triple-A home run in 2026. Saggese and first baseman Ramon Mendoza both posted a multi-hit effort while second baseman Noah Mendlinger drove in two runs. 

Starting pitcher Jared Shuster allowed two runs on three hits, walked one and struck out two over 2.1 innings pitched. Hancel Rincón and Victor santos posted scoreless relief work for Memphis in the back end of the doubleheader.  

The Memphis Redbirds return to AutoZone Park on Tuesday, August 4 to begin a six-game homestand against the Nashville Sounds (Triple-A, Milwaukee Brewers) with first pitch scheduled for 6:45 p.m. CDT.  

About the Memphis Redbirds  

The Memphis Redbirds are the proud Triple-A affiliate of the St. Louis Cardinals. Since their affiliation with St. Louis began in 1998, the Redbirds have claimed four League Championships and one Triple-A National Championship. Based in Memphis, Tennessee, the Redbirds play their home games at AutoZone Park, one of the premier ballparks in the nation.
